namespace LeanCloud { /// /// Represents a distance between two AVGeoPoints. /// public struct AVGeoDistance { private const double EarthMeanRadiusKilometers = 6371.0; private const double EarthMeanRadiusMiles = 3958.8; /// /// Creates a AVGeoDistance. /// /// The distance in radians. public AVGeoDistance(double radians) : this() { Radians = radians; } /// /// Gets the distance in radians. /// public double Radians { get; private set; } /// /// Gets the distance in miles. /// public double Miles { get { return Radians * EarthMeanRadiusMiles; } } /// /// Gets the distance in kilometers. /// public double Kilometers { get { return Radians * EarthMeanRadiusKilometers; } } /// /// Gets a AVGeoDistance from a number of miles. /// /// The number of miles. /// A AVGeoDistance for the given number of miles. public static AVGeoDistance FromMiles(double miles) { return new AVGeoDistance(miles / EarthMeanRadiusMiles); } /// /// Gets a AVGeoDistance from a number of kilometers. /// /// The number of kilometers. /// A AVGeoDistance for the given number of kilometers. public static AVGeoDistance FromKilometers(double kilometers) { return new AVGeoDistance(kilometers / EarthMeanRadiusKilometers); } /// /// Gets a AVGeoDistance from a number of radians. /// /// The number of radians. /// A AVGeoDistance for the given number of radians. public static AVGeoDistance FromRadians(double radians) { return new AVGeoDistance(radians); } } }
